DescriptionA. Vogel Echinaforce Tablets is a completely herbal supplement made from echinacea to support the immune system and treat the symptoms of colds, flu and other upper respiratory tract conditions. Reviews0 A. Vogel Echinaforce Tablets is a completely herbal supplement made from echinacea to support the immune system and treat the symptoms of colds, flu and other upper respiratory tract conditions. Write a review There are no reviews yet